Why Hydration Myths Spread So Easily
Water is fundamental to life, which means advice about drinking it carries an almost automatic authority. When a figure like 'eight glasses a day' gets repeated by enough voices — from wellness blogs to well-meaning family members — it starts to feel like established science even when the evidence is thin. Hydration is also a topic where individual variation is enormous, making simple universal rules both appealing and misleading.
The myths below are among the most commonly repeated. Each one contains a kernel of logic, which is partly why they persist. Understanding where they come from — and where they go wrong — makes it easier to think clearly about how much, and what, to actually drink. Myth
Everyone needs exactly eight glasses of water every day to stay properly hydrated.
Fact
There is no universal eight-glass requirement. Fluid needs vary widely based on body size, activity level, climate, and diet.
The '8×8' rule — eight 8-ounce glasses per day — is one of the most persistent beliefs in nutrition, yet it lacks a clear scientific origin. Researchers who have examined the evidence, including a widely cited 2002 review in the American Journal of Physiology, found no solid scientific support for the figure. The U.S. National Academies of Sciences suggests general daily fluid adequate intakes (around 3.7 liters for men and 2.7 liters for women), but these totals include water from all food and beverages — not just drinking water — and represent averages, not prescriptions. A petite sedentary person in a cool climate has genuinely different needs than a large athlete in summer heat.
Myth
If you feel thirsty, you are already dehydrated and have waited too long.
Fact
Thirst is the body's normal, timely signal to drink — not a sign that you have already crossed into dehydration.
This myth encourages people to drink on a schedule rather than listening to their body, which can backfire. For healthy adults, thirst is a well-calibrated mechanism. Mild fluid deficit does trigger thirst well before performance or health is meaningfully compromised. The exception worth noting is older adults, whose thirst sensation can diminish with age, making it a less reliable sole guide. In those cases, regular drinking habits — independent of thirst — can be a sensible strategy, but this applies to a specific population, not everyone.
Myth
Coffee and tea dehydrate you, so they don't count toward your fluid intake.
Fact
Caffeinated beverages do have a mild diuretic effect, but the net fluid they deliver still contributes positively to hydration.
Caffeine stimulates a slight increase in urine output, which led to the widespread belief that coffee and tea dehydrate. However, a significant body of research — including studies published in the journal PLOS ONE — has found that moderate coffee consumption (around 3–4 cups per day) is not associated with dehydration in regular drinkers. The water content of these beverages substantially outweighs any diuretic effect. Both coffee and tea are primarily water and count meaningfully toward your daily fluid total. Very large doses of caffeine from concentrated sources are a different matter, but ordinary cup-by-cup consumption is not a hydration liability.
Myth
Clear urine means you are perfectly hydrated; any color at all signals a problem.
Fact
Pale yellow urine generally indicates good hydration. Completely colorless urine may mean you are drinking more than necessary.
Urine color charts — ranging from pale straw to deep amber — are a reasonable rough guide, but they are far from precise. Many factors besides hydration affect urine color: B-vitamin supplements can turn urine bright yellow regardless of fluid intake; beets can produce a reddish tint; and certain medications alter color entirely. Consistently clear, odorless urine throughout the day can actually suggest over-hydration, which, in extreme cases, can dilute electrolytes and create its own problems. Pale yellow is generally considered the target. It's also worth knowing that your food contributes significantly to hydration, so color alone tells only part of the story.
Myth
You need sports drinks or electrolyte supplements to rehydrate after any exercise.
Fact
Electrolyte drinks are beneficial mainly for prolonged or intense exercise. Water is typically sufficient for everyday activity.
Sports drinks were developed for endurance athletes — people exercising intensely for 60 to 90 minutes or more, sweating heavily and losing meaningful sodium. For a 30-minute walk or a casual gym session, plain water replaces what most people lose without any special formulation needed. Consuming electrolyte drinks unnecessarily adds sugar and sodium without a physiological benefit. The confusion partly stems from effective marketing rather than broad nutritional need. If you are doing genuinely prolonged, sweat-heavy exercise, an electrolyte source can be helpful — but that threshold is higher than most people reach in daily life.
What Actually Shapes Your Hydration Needs
Rather than chasing a fixed number, it helps to understand the real variables that influence how much fluid your body needs on any given day.

- Body size and composition: Larger bodies and those with more muscle mass generally require more water, since muscle holds more water than fat tissue.
- Activity level: Physical exertion increases fluid loss through sweat, so active days require proportionally more intake.
- Climate and environment: Heat and low humidity accelerate fluid loss through both sweat and respiration.

Over-Hydration Is a Real Risk
Drinking far more water than your body needs can dilute sodium and other electrolytes in the blood, a condition called hyponatremia. It is rare in everyday life but has occurred in endurance events where athletes drink large volumes of plain water without replacing electrolytes. Drinking to satisfy thirst — rather than following an aggressive intake target — is a sensible guard against both under- and over-hydration for most healthy adults.
